Katahdin 360 is a world class bikepack loop circumnavigating Maine's tallest mountain, Katahdin. Follow Chris & Chris, and their friend Andy, as they ride 125 miles of some of the best gravel on the planet.
The route works it's way through Katahdin Woods & Waters National Monument, offering epic views of the mountain while following the mystical East Branch of the Penobscot River. Linking up several public access logging roads and even some unimproved roads untouched by vehicles in many years, it eventually arrives at Baxter State Park tote road, a (mostly) hard packed and truly perfect gravel surface for biking.

Great ride and video guys! Did you need a reservation for the lean to or is it a first come, first serve scenario? Ty
@chrisandchris
@chrisandchris 4 ай бұрын
You’ll need to register when entering Baxter State Park (it’s free for cyclists), and you’ll need a reservation made via their website to stay at any campground area inside of the park. Most are usually booked well in advance because it’s a popular place, but you’re usually good earlier in the summer. We’d recommend riding through the park counterclockwise (entering from the North entrance), and staying at either South Branch or Nesowadnehunk Field Campground. You’ll want to familiarize yourself with Baxter State Park and all of its unique rules & regulations as well, so check out their website!
